Kitasato Institute

Shibasaburo Kitasato established the Kitasato Institute in Tokyo in 1914 after resigning from the government Institute for Infectious Diseases when its administrative control changed.

The institute connected laboratory research to prevention and treatment while asserting that scientific work required an institutional setting with its own leadership, resources, collaborators, and practical mission.

Laboratory and society

Research was expected to produce practical health.

Kitasato had trained in Robert Koch's laboratory in Germany and became known for work on tetanus, serotherapy, and plague. In Japan he built organisations able to sustain experimental medicine beyond an individual career.

Microbes required infrastructure

Culture media, experimental animals, microscopes, sterile routines, records, and trained assistants made bacteriology possible. Stable laboratories converted fragile experiments into repeatable programmes of investigation.

Prevention connected bench and public

The institute treated infectious-disease research as applied science. Tests, sera, vaccines, hospitals, and health education carried laboratory claims toward patients and populations, although adoption depended on production and trust as well as discovery.

Teaching extended a lineage

Researchers trained other investigators who created work of their own. Scientific schools emerge through shared techniques, criticism, employment, and access to equipment—not simply through loyalty to a celebrated founder.

Independence and authority

Institutional control shaped which science could continue.

The immediate context of the 1914 foundation was an administrative dispute. When the earlier infectious-disease institute moved under Tokyo Imperial University, Kitasato and colleagues left to establish a private alternative. The episode joined questions of scientific autonomy to funding, governance, and personal authority.

Private status did not eliminate dependence. Donations, fees, product income, regulation, and cooperation with public authorities shaped what could be sustained. Autonomy was therefore negotiated through relationships rather than secured once by the act of founding.

Accounts centred on Kitasato can obscure collective labour. Assistants, technicians, clinicians, patients, animal handlers, manufacturers, donors, and public officials all helped produce research and apply it. Credit did not necessarily follow contribution evenly.

The institute later expanded through hospitals, a university, pharmacy, allied health, and additional research organisations. Work associated with Satoshi Omura and microorganism-derived compounds demonstrates the continuing value of collecting, culturing, screening, and collaborating across institutional and national boundaries.

Its history also complicates a simple transfer from Europe to Japan. German laboratory methods mattered, but Japanese researchers selected problems, built organisations, trained colleagues, and made claims within domestic public-health and political systems. Imported techniques became locally governed scientific infrastructure.
